I have the ATS manifold on mine and am fairly happy with it. Its built tough and made to last and so far in the 20k its neem on my truck it has worked fine. The only complaint I have with it is their TERRIBLE heat coating that disappears and allow the manifold to rust on the outside bad. IF I did it again I would go to High Tech Turbo's and have them HPC coat it before it came to me.



I am not sure there is much difference between the three manifolds,ATS,HTT's and B-D's for power and it more a personal favorite choice to me. I went ATS because the shop who did my work stocked them... ... ... Andy

Do any of these manifolds have the boss for attaching the heater tube? Or what did you use to support the tube? I see HTT has a bracket for this. What about port size? Do they match the gaskets or head? HTT claims to be port matched. They appear to be similar in price. Shadrach
 
I don't think any of them match the gaskets. (which is unnecessary BTW)



on a 12v, the port entries are rectangular, but then there is a rough transition over to the round ports. my ATS and HTT were like that. I ported/blended my HTT. Can't say I noticed any difference.
